Summary
Overview
In 2024, Dehradun averaged an AQI of 106 while Hyderabad averaged 78 — a 28-point (36%) gap, with Dehradun the more polluted and Hyderabad the cleaner of the two. On 502 days when both cities reported, Dehradun was cleaner on 377 of them; the average daily gap was 59 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Dehradun peaks in January, while Hyderabad peaks in December. Dehradun logged 0% Severe days and 62.8%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Hyderabad was 0.2% Severe and 41.6%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Dehradun 41 days, Hyderabad 71 days.
Year-over-year progress
Dehradun has worsened by 19 AQI points (21.8%) from 2022 to 2024; Hyderabad has improved by 24 AQI points (23.5%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Dehradun reached AQI 327 at Doon University (UKPCB) on 2024-01-19; Hyderabad hit AQI 500 at Sanathnagar (TSPCB) on 2024-04-28.
Station-level disparity
Dehradun spans 1 CPCB stations with a 0-point spread (min 98, max 98); Hyderabad spans 14 stations with a 35-point spread (min 62, max 97).
